Advanced threading technology has become important for safety and durability because EVs face higher torque loads and vibration stress.
It is a cold-forming process where threads are created by compressing material instead of cutting it. A Thread Rolling Machine is used for improving grain structure and surface finish. The principle of the thread rolling machine increases tensile strength and fatigue resistance, making it ideal for electric vehicle fasteners that must withstand constant vibration and thermal cycles.

Here is the comparison table of thread rolling and thread cutting.
| Parameter | Thread Rolling | Thread Cutting |
|---|---|---|
| Material Removal | No | Yes |
| Grain Flow | Continuous | Interrupted |
| Fatigue Strength | Higher | Lower |
| Surface Finish | Smooth | Rough |
| Production Speed | High | Moderate |
| Material Waste | Minimal | Higher |
| EV Suitability | Excellent | Limited |

Ans: Thread rolling is crucial for EV manufacturing because electric vehicles operate under high torque and vibration conditions. Rolled threads offer better fatigue resistance, improved grain flow, and stronger load-bearing capacity compared to cut threads. This ensures that battery packs, motor assemblies, and structural components remain securely fastened, improving vehicle safety, durability, and long-term performance in demanding operating environments.
Ans: Thread rolling strengthens fasteners through cold forming, which compresses the material instead of cutting it. This process maintains a continuous grain structure and eliminates weak points caused by material removal. As a result, rolled threads exhibit higher tensile strength and better resistance to cracking. For EVs, where safety and reliability are critical, this added durability ensures long operational life and reduced component failure risks.
